Things you can do before selling your home to make it more appealing to buyers:
Cleaned the carpets
Straightened out the closets
Paint any needed trim or walls
Get rid of unneeded clutter or furniture to make the home show larger
spruce up the landscaping.
Have the home clean and presentable for each showing.
Neutralize, neutralize, neutralize
Do not overprice
Be sure to listen carefully to all the buyer's terms, not just the price.
Remember time is money and an overpriced home many times does not get offers or gets very low offers you may find insulting.
Be careful when selling and ask a lot of questions of your professional.
When your agent suggests a listing price review the information provided and remember to look and see if the homes are similar, how far away they are, how long it took them to sell and how many times did they reduce the price and from what before selling.
Many agents show you the homes which are currently on the market, so remember to ask the same questions because if you are basing your price on another home which is significantly over priced it can mean nothing but wasted time and money for you.
Many real estate agents are not as strict in the criteria they use when suggesting a list price as an appraiser is at determining an opinion of value. We rarely use something which has not sold as a comparable to a home other than to show market stability, decline, increase, support of values or for forecasting trends.
